I wondered if someone would be kind enough to answer a query regarding turnout in a sidesaddle riding class. I am originally from England where rules on turnout for all equitation classes were very strict, and I have continued to ride according the English rules over here in Queensland. Side saddle riding does not seem to have much of a following here and I am not too sure that judges know what they should be looking at but I am seeking some guidance on acceptable turnout here in Australia. At Toowoomba Royal Show this week a competitor riding in a bridle with a crystal sparkly browband, a schooling whip of around 120cm, a “period costume type” habit with an apron so short it showed both the left and the right riding boot, a jacket with no cut away front and brass buttons over the rear (single) vent and no waistcoat was placed first in the rider class. She rode well and her horse went nicely but her turnout was incorrect (to my English showing eyes!) My query is, does it matter what you and your horse wear if it is a riding class because turnout is not considered, only the horse’s way of going and one’s riding ability?
